Easy Baked Reuben Casserole

- 1 pound sauerkraut, rinsed and drained, with most of the liquid squeezed out
- ½ teaspoon ground black pepper
- 1 teaspoon sea salt
- 1 pound sliced corned beef, torn into large pieces
- 12 slices Swiss cheese
- ¼ cup Thousand Island dressing
- 6 slices rye bread, torn into smaller pieces
- 2 tablespoons melted butter
Preheat oven to 350 degrees
Grease a 9 X 13-inch baking dish with cooking spray, oil or butter
Spread the sauerkraut evenly over the bottom of the baking dish, and season with sea salt and pepper
Layer the corned beef over the sauerkraut
Layer the Swiss cheese over the beef
Spread the dressing evenly over the cheese, and top with rye bread
Drizzle the melted butter over the bread
Bake for 30 minutes, remove from oven, slice, and serve warm
You can use leftover corned beef or sliced deli meat in this recipe.
Substitute provolone cheese for Swiss cheese if desired.
